I am slowly building a classroom library for my juniors and seniors so they can be exposed to a wider variety of literature. Many of my students live in poverty and deal with issues of homelessness, substance abuse, and domestic violence. They are not in a position to go to the bookstore to buy a book, or even to the public library to check out a book because they are working to put food on their table, pay the rent, take care of younger siblings, etc. I would like them to have the chance to use literature as a little escape from their everyday lives.
Research shows that independent reading is one of the most successful ways to build a student's vocabulary, as well as build empathy in them as people. Unfortunately, these students are very often the students who do not have the drive or opportunity to read for pleasure.
